Over 20 years since Dawit Isaak was imprisoned: “He didn’t want to leave us”

Ever since the journalist Dawit Isaak was imprisoned in Eritrea in 2001, his wife Sofia Berhane has been waiting for him to be released. In the documentary “Dagar utan dig”, she talks about missing her husband.

– How can I leave him when he is in the dark? He didn’t want to leave us, she says.

The documentary “Days without you” follows Betlehem Isaak’s search for his father, the Swedish-Eritrean journalist and writer Dawit Isaak.

In the clip above, Dawit Isaak’s wife Sofia Berhane talks about why she is still waiting for her husband to come back to her.
